Title: Photograph of Apollo 17 lunar landing site location
Description:
A vertical view of the Taurus-Littrow landing area photographed on an
earlier Apollo mission from lunar orbit. The mission photograph is
surrounded on all sides by a computer-generated 360-degree panorama of the
region as seen by an observer at the nominal Apollo 17 Lunar Module
Landing site. The 360-degree panorama is divided into four sections,
north-east-south-west. Each section includes an overlap of about 15
degrees with each adjacent section. The observer's eye level is 1.8 meters
above the surface. The features on the panorama were marked by an overlay
on the photograph. The panoramic scene was generated by processing a
digitized form of the U.S. Army TOPCOM compilation of the terrain contours
in the Taurus-Littrow landing area.
